5’11 and 180lbs getting a lot of fake natty accusations for my delts. But any tips for chest and lat growth? by Round_Cycle595 in Weightliftingquestion

[–]Landashlo 0 points1 point  (0 children)

For Lats I prefer single arm movements. It’s a lot easier to make the line of force better and to stack yo the joints and be more precise.

For chest id use more machines. More stable and easier to focus on the intended muscle.

Also really spend some extra time in the lengthened position.

Advice on getting Arms bigger? by RandomBluz in workout

[–]Landashlo 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Would getting a gym membership be an option? If so, try to go there and do some bicep curls and tricep extensions. Try using machines first since it can be a bit easier if you’re new. I’d recommend a preacher curl and just a regular cable curl to start with. For triceps I’d just start with a pushdown or extension. Try a few sets until you get more comfortable.

You can YouTube search the exercises I mentioned and you’ll see how to execute them properly.

Aim for at least 100-150g protein daily, should be sufficient in the beginning.

Protein for building muscle - complete vs incomplete ratio by Nice_Pen_8054 in workout

[–]Landashlo 1 point2 points  (0 children)

It doesn’t necessarily need to be from the animal kingdom but it needs to be complete protein meaning that it contains all 9 essential amino acids. You should be good
